COMMISSION ON CIVIL RIGHTS
Sunshine Act Notice
AGENCY: United States Commission on Civil Rights.
ACTION: Notice of meeting.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
DATE AND TIME: Friday, May 13, 2011; 9 a.m. EDT.
PLACE: The Washington Marriott at Metro Center, Junior Ballroom Salons
1 and 2, 775 12th Street, NW., Washington, DC 20005.
Briefing Agenda
This briefing is open to the public.
Topic: Peer-to-Peer Violence and Bullying: Examining the Federal
Response
I. Introductory Remarks by Chairman
II. Speakers' Presentations
III. Questions by Commissioners and Staff Director
IV. Adjourn Briefing
